Peer reviewedFarmer, Edward L. – History Teacher, 1985
As a counter to Europocentric views, a comparative approach should be used to study the history of European civilization in the premodern period. A framework for considering European history in comparison to that of three other civilizations is presented. (RM)

Peer reviewedSchuck, Robert F. – Journal of Teacher Education, 1985
An investigation addressed the comparative impact of two teaching skills upon student achievement and retention. The power of set induction and systematic questioning as instructional tools was reconfirmed by the research. (Author/CB)

Thomas, Stephen B. – Health Education (Washington D.C.), 1984
This article discusses holistic philosophy and its relationship to health education. The holistic approach serves to facilitate health as a positive condition of the individual as a whole. The following holistic viewpoints are explained: the nature of man and the universe, relationship of mind to body, human personality, and cause and effect. (DF)

Peer reviewedConner, Ross F. – New Directions for Program Evaluation, 1985
The author compares his experiences evaluating Peace Corps volunteers in Kenya and evaluating a health promotion program for adolescents in Orange County, California. Doing international evaluations can improve domestic evaluations by heightening awareness of often unrecognized cultural variations in the domestic setting. (BS)

Peer reviewedTorsney, Cheryl B. – Exercise Exchange, 1984
Describes reviewing the basics of descriptive writing by having students compare the images described in E. B. White's "Once More to the Lake," with those in the film "On Golden Pond." Students then write a descriptive paragraph, from an internal or external perspective, about a magazine advertisement chosen for its sensory appeal. (HTH)
